book - On Thursday 1st July 1999, Dr Nina Simone gave a rare
performance as part of Nick Cave's Meltdown Festival. After the show,
in a state of awe, Warren Ellis crept onto the stage,took Dr Simone's
piece of chewed gum from the piano, wrapped it in her stage towel and
put it in a Tower Records bag. The gum remained with him for twenty
years; a sacred totem, his creative muse, a conduit that would
eventually take Ellis back tohis childhood and his relationship with
found objects, growing in significance with every passing year. 'Nina
Simone's Gum' is about how something so small can form beautiful
connections between people. It is a story about the meaning we place
on things, on experiences, and how they become imbued with
spirituality. It is a celebration of artistic process, friendship,
understanding and love. Complete with a title-embossed outer dust
